AutomatedAgentConfig(mapping=None, *, ignore_unknown_fields=False, **kwargs)
Defines the Automated Agent to connect to a conversation. .. attribute:: agent
Required. ID of the Dialogflow agent environment to use.
This project needs to either be the same project as the
conversation or you need to grant
service-<Conversation Project Number>@gcp-sa-dialogflow.iam.gserviceaccount.com
the Dialogflow API Service Agent
role in this project.
For ES agents, use format:
projects/<Project ID>/locations/<Location ID>/agent/environments/<Environment ID or '-'>
. If environment is not specified, the defaultdraft
environment is used. Refer toDetectIntentRequest </dialogflow/docs/reference/rpc/google.cloud.dialogflow.v2beta1#google.cloud.dialogflow.v2beta1.DetectIntentRequest>
__ for more details.For CX agents, use format
projects/<Project ID>/locations/<Location ID>/agents/<Agent ID>/environments/<Environment ID or '-'>
. If environment is not specified, the defaultdraft
environment is used.:type: str
